Where Scratches Usually Start

Entryways, hallways, kitchens, and family rooms often show surface wear first because these areas receive repeated traffic. Grit tracked in from outside, pet nails, chair legs, toys, and dragged furniture can all create scratches or scuffs if the floor surface is not durable enough.

What Improves Scratch Resistance

The wear layer is the most important feature to compare. A stronger wear layer provides better protection against daily abrasion. Surface texture and finish also matter. Matte or lightly textured finishes tend to hide minor marks better than glossy floors.

How to Protect the Floor

Use mats near exterior doors, place felt pads under furniture, keep pet nails trimmed, clean grit regularly, and avoid dragging heavy objects. These simple habits can help preserve the finish and extend the useful life of the flooring.
